Find x and the length of each side if AFGH is an equilateral triangle.

a) 3x + 10
b) 5x - 8
c) 4x + 1
d) Equilateral triangle sides have equal lengths.

1 Answer

3 votes

Final answer:

To find the length of each side of the equilateral triangle, set the given expressions for the sides equal to each other and solve for x. The length of each side can be found by substituting the value of x into any of the expressions a), b), or c).

Step-by-step explanation:

To find the length of each side of the equilateral triangle, we need to set the given expressions for the sides equal to each other. Since all sides of an equilateral triangle are equal, we can set the expressions equal to each other and solve for x.

a) 3x + 10 = 5x - 8

Subtract 3x from each side: 10 = 2x - 8

Add 8 to each side: 18 = 2x

Divide each side by 2: 9 = x

Therefore, x = 9.

The length of each side of the equilateral triangle is given by any of the expressions a), b), or c), so substituting x = 9 into any of them will give us the length of each side.
